1944 Photo of T-14 6×6 on eBay
This is a print from an original negative, though the seller doesn’t specifically say that he printed it (but I get the sense that is what he did … I have enhanced the photo to make it easier to see). It’s a Willys T-14 6×6. Mark Askew, in his Rare WW2 Jeep book, has a couple photos of it from different angles, but not this one. It is one of four photos for sale as part of the auction.
Here I have an 8 ½ x 11 inch print from the original negative number 10B-36 of 4 Willys Overland Jeeps, 3 of which are tracked
Photos are marked as:
RT-284 TRACK LAYING JEEP – TJ MARK I – NO 1 WILLYS OVERLAND ENGINEERING NO. 2491-5-20-44
TRACKED JEEP – MODEL WT-0, SERIAL 02 – WITH GOODRICH TRACK RT-245 WILLYS OVERLAND – ENGINEERING NO. 2993-12-5-44
WILLYS MODEL MT-14 6×6 GUN CARRIER TOP AND SIDE CURTAINS INSTALLED W. O. ENG. NO. 1894-1-24-44
Very rare Piece for the Willys / Jeep Collector!”

Year? Scamp? Sacramento, CA **SOLD**
UPDATE: **SOLD** Was No Price.
The seller believes this has a 1946 body, but looks more like a replica body. This may actually be a SCAMP rather than a VEEP.
“Fun to drive, draws attention and looks from admirers, great for street or desert.
This is a conversion of a 1946 Willy’s cj3a (army style) jeep into what was called back in the ’70’s a “Veep”, which meant a steel Jeep body with VW bug running gear (motor and trans). The Jeep body came out of a shipping crate never been assembled when i opened it and bolted it together in 2004. The engine is a dual port stock 1600cc air-cooled motor with a single solex 30 carburetor built in 2004. It has a type 1 transmission with standard 4-spd manual shifting. 1960? DJ-3A Ventura, CA **SOLD**
UPDATE: **SOLD** Was $3950. Might have been a Pepsi Surrey.
Per Colin, 56337 18392 1960 DJ3A Yellow, floor shift, some modifications, bucket seats, chrome windshield grab bars, chrome front bumper. Could this have been a Pepsi Surrey? Very close to numbers of other Pepsi Surreys.
This is owned by Sherri and had the DJ featured in a magazine (Four Wheeler?). At some point, this jeep was stolen. It was returned to her in poor shape. It needs some restoration. (At least, that’s what I understand based on the text below).
